I while back i tried to mess with the card picture file. Since then I haven't been able to download any new card pictures. Where is the card picture file? And how do I access it? Are they hidden?
Re: Forge and Macs using Mac OS X Mavericks
by shinra » 28 May 2015, 18:30
I Goose!
Yes on iOS, the Pics folder is hidden. On your Desktop, locate the upper task bar and find "Go".
Then push alt on your Keyboard and click "Library" who magically appear on the list
Then:
"Library/Cache/Forge/Pics" and push all pics inside
Be careful if you are using softs like "Clean my Mac" cause it clean all the Cache folder every time so make a new exception before
